This painting shows a nude woman standing with her back to us. She has curly hair and is facing a chair with a patterned back. The background is full of patterns too. The patterns in the background and on the chair are made up of lines and shapes. They add a lot of texture to the painting. The woman's body is drawn in simple lines, but you can still see her curves. The artist, William Copley, used charcoal to create this piece.
